Product description

Lucie’s mother has died, leaving her as the middle child in a family devastated by grief. Lucie, her brother Hugo, big sister Chloe and Dad are struggling to cope with the emotional fallout of losing someone so close, as well as the practical realities of death – from clearing out a wardrobe to learning to cook. As if things weren’t tough enough, Lucie is also trying to navigate the challenges of turning eleven: her baffling first kiss, her big sister’s moods… How will she cope without Mum there to guide her? A moving story of love, loss and hope, told through Lucie’s own letters.
